A simulation-based method for evaluating the reliability of vehicle routing schemes in the vaccine delivery with vehicle breakdown

摘要

This paper introduces the vehicle routing problem of the vaccine delivery with vehicle breakdowns. In the delivery process of vaccines, a continuous low-temperature environment is required. Once any event that causes the temperature to rise happens during the whole process, the quality of vaccines cannot be assured, and even human lives that are injected by the vaccines are threatened. Therefore, this paper presents a method to evaluate the reliability of vehicle routing schemes in the vaccine delivery with vehicle breakdown. The method adopts the simulation idea and supposes breakdowns at every fixed time interval for each vehicle. When a supposed vehicle breakdown happens, a saving-based heuristic will be applied to generate a rescue scheme. Finally, the method was coded and run on one of the classical CVRP instances.
